Atrichous

/əˈtrɪkəs/ adjective

Definition

Lacking hair; hairless or characterized by absence of hair growth.

Etymology

From Greek a- 'without' + thrix (trichos) 'hair' + -ous adjectival suffix. Used in both medical and biological contexts to describe hairless organisms or body parts.

Kelly Says

Interestingly, some bacteria are described as 'atrichous' because they lack flagella (hair-like structures for movement), showing how biology borrows hair-related words beyond humans.
